GOAL
The goal of Unificación Maya is to bring together a great number of like minded people, synchronizing their energies through a week of music, dance and ceremony, gathering finally in the Central Plaza of Tikal at the winter solstice, the time of rebirth, to link themselves with the Earth, with the Center of the Universe, and with each other in a giant web of energy as we move through the steps of the Dance of Unificación which will act like a key turning in a lock to open the gateway to the next dimension.
YOU WILL
Discover your Mayan Birth Glyph; participate in Sacred Mayan Fire Ceremonies; visit and learn about several of the most impressive of the ancient Mayan sites; become familiar with the flora and fauna and its place in local diversity; sample a variety of local foods and beverages; learn about Mayan and Toltec Cosmology; enjoy different types of indigenous music from marimba to flute to guitar; and spend personal time with the special people who are the tatas and nanas of the present-day Maya.
